maclatunji: ^You guys have been working on this for some time. If I am not mistaken, Bino and Fino started out as muppets. These things take time. A lot goes into it. We'll keep working on the project because we passionately believe it is needed for kids out there and so do parents we've spoken to. We've finished the 1st TV feature and are the first in this region of the world to do so. We are now producing a whole new season of 26 episodes which will be completed next year. The muppets as you put are still here. |
